What We Do Halcyon is the industry’s first dedicated, adaptive security platform that combines multiple proprietary advanced prevention engines along with AI models focused specifically on stopping ransomware.

Who We Are Halcyon was formed in 2021 by a team of cyber industry veterans after battling the scourge of ransomware and advanced threats. Leaders from Cylance, Accuvant, Fireye and ISS X‑Force helped build a company focused on products and solutions for mid‑market and enterprise customers. As a remote‑native, distributed global team, we recognize that great talent can exist anywhere.

The Role Halcyon is seeking a highly experienced and results‑driven Sales Director to lead and oversee the commercial and enterprise sales strategy within the Canada region. The ideal candidate will drive revenue growth, manage high‑performance sales teams, build strategic partnerships, and execute sales strategies aligned with our mission of combating ransomware threats.

Responsibilities

Lead and manage a regional sales team focused on commercial and enterprise accounts, ensuring the execution of company sales strategies. Foster a high‑performance sales culture, setting clear targets, providing coaching, and holding team members accountable for meeting revenue goals.

Develop and execute region‑specific sales plans and go‑to‑market strategies that align with corporate objectives. Identify market trends, potential client needs, and competitive advantages to drive product adoption across various industries.

Achieve and exceed sales targets by acquiring new customers, expanding existing customer accounts, and ensuring long‑term retention. Take responsibility for the region’s overall revenue performance, including forecasting and pipeline management.

Build and maintain strong relationships with key decision‑makers within target accounts, including CISOs, CTOs, and senior executives. Work closely with enterprise and mid‑market customers to understand their ransomware protection needs and deliver tailored solutions.

Collaborate with marketing, product, customer success, and operations teams to ensure alignment in product offerings and a seamless customer experience. Provide valuable customer feedback to shape product development and messaging.

Work with the training and development team to ensure sales representatives are fully equipped with the necessary tools, knowledge, and resources to succeed. Lead the recruitment, development, and mentorship of sales talent.

Provide regular reporting on sales performance, forecast accuracy, and key performance indicators (KPIs) to senior management. Utilize CRM and other sales tools to track progress and optimize sales processes.

Support sales teams in closing large, complex deals by engaging directly with high‑value clients and participating in the negotiation process.

Skills and Qualifications

Minimum of 5+ years of experience leading commercial and enterprise sales, with a proven track record in driving revenue growth in the cybersecurity, SaaS, or technology sectors, while coaching and mentoring sales teams.

Experience selling security solutions, particularly around ransomware protection, data privacy, and endpoint security, is highly preferred.

Strong understanding of cybersecurity threats, trends, and best practices.

Proven experience developing and executing sales strategies and achieving sales quotas.

Base Salary Range CAD 190,000.00 – CAD 225,000.00

In accordance with applicable state and federal laws, the range provided is Halcyon’s reasonable estimate of the base compensation for this role. The actual amount may differ based on non‑discriminatory factors such as experience, knowledge, skills, abilities, and location. Base pay is one part of the total package provided to compensate and recognize employees for their work; this role may also be eligible for additional discretionary bonuses/incentives and equity in the company.
